Output 7883ee48974c3317554368c17e6633b958c2a00a432cef328d55dfe3a67c1ea7:0

value
82186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e233dfef225b77dc05cb1114533a6ecf4dfb51 OP_EQUAL
address
3CM3HdY5s75AGYkMihEoauVLjNRZndA3yA
transaction
7883ee48974c3317554368c17e6633b958c2a00a432cef328d55dfe3a67c1ea7
spent
true